i^0 = 1 by definition of "power 0"
i^1 = i
i^2 = -1 by definition of i *
i^3 = -i because i^3 = i*i^2 = i(-1)
i^4 = +1 because i^4 = (i^2)^2 = (-1)^2 = 1 = i^0
and the cycle repeats itself.
i^n ?
Divide n by 4
keep only the remainder
look it up on the cycle list.
i^51 is the same as i^3
because i^51 = (i^48)(i^3) = 1(i^3) = -i
i^399 is the same as i^3
i^399 = (i^396)(i^3) = 1(i^3) = -i
sum = -2i
---
* in maths, it is i^2 which is defined, not i.
